On 05/31/2014 12:49 PM, Hans Hagen wrote:
> On 5/31/2014 8:30 AM, Pablo Rodriguez wrote:
>> [...]
>> If I disable \setuptagging, output is fine. But with \setuptagging
>> enabled, the typing environment doesn’t display multiple lines.
>>
>> Am I doing something wrong or have I hit a bug?
> 
> The space in verbatim is defined differently because otherwise it can 
> get lost in the export; you can experiment with:
> 
> \appendtoks
>      \unexpanded\def\obeyedspace{\hskip\zeropoint\char32\hskip\zeropoint}%
> \to \everyenableelements

Many thanks for your reply, Hans.

I’m afraid I cannot make it work even with the minimal sample:

    \setuppapersize[A6]
    \setuptagging[state=start]
    \setuptyping[margin=yes,align={right,broad}]
    \appendtoks
     \unexpanded\def\obeyedspace{\hskip\zeropoint\char32\hskip%
       \zeropoint}%
    \to \everyenableelements
    \starttext
    \starttyping
    \setuptyping[margin=yes, align={right,broad}]
    \stoptyping
    \stoptext

Since I’m not familiar with \appendtoks, I don’t know whether I applied
it right.

Is your code applied right in the sample above?
